119. 3 Steps to Find the Desires Hidden beneath Your Habits
Are you an overthinker? Maybe a procrastinator or a perfectionist? We all have habits—things we do automatically without thinking much about them—that are deeply ingrained in us, but our habits are need indicators; they signal a need or desire. Luckily, there are steps you can take to uncover those needs and desires, which will allow you to identify, address, and then change those habits more effectively.
Tune in this week as I share some examples of specific habits many people have and the needs and desires behind them. Learn why the needs and desires behind a habitual pattern are usually hidden, the mindset required to uncover them, and the detailed steps you can take to address the root cause of your habits.
